/*
* \brief Simple fork test
* \author Norman Feske
* \date 2012-02-14
*/
#include <stdio.h>
#include <unistd.h>
#include <errno.h>
#include <sys/wait.h>
enum { MAX_COUNT = 1000 };
int main(int, char **)
{
printf("--- test-noux_fork started ---\n");
pid_t fork_ret = fork();
if (fork_ret < 0) {
printf("Error: fork returned %d, errno=%d\n", fork_ret, errno);
return -1;
}
printf("pid %d: fork returned %d\n", getpid(), fork_ret);
/* child */
if (fork_ret == 0) {
printf("pid %d: child says hello\n", getpid());
pid_t fork_ret = fork();
if (fork_ret < 0) {
printf("Error: fork returned %d, errno=%d\n", fork_ret, errno);
return -1;
}
printf("pid %d: fork returned %d\n", getpid(), fork_ret);
/* grand child */
if (fork_ret == 0) {
printf("pid %d: grand child says hello\n", getpid());
for (int k = 0; k < MAX_COUNT; k++) {
printf("pid %d: grand child k = %d\n", getpid(), k);
}
return 0;
};
for (int j = 0; j < MAX_COUNT; j++) {
printf("pid %d: child j = %d\n", getpid(), j);
}
if (fork_ret != 0) {
printf("pid %d: child waits for grand-child exit\n", getpid());
waitpid(fork_ret, nullptr, 0);
}
return 0;
}
printf("pid %d: parent received child pid %d, starts counting...\n",
getpid(), fork_ret);
for (int i = 0; i < MAX_COUNT; ) {
printf("pid %d: parent i = %d\n", getpid(), i++);
}
printf("pid %d: parent waits for child exit\n", getpid());
waitpid(fork_ret, nullptr, 0);
printf("--- parent done ---\n");
return 0;
}
